assignment 1
assignment 1
Project management software is a tool that helps individuals and teams plan, organize, and manage
tasks and resources to achieve specific project goals. It provides features such as task scheduling,
resource allocation, budgeting, communication tools, and reporting capabilities.
A desktop project management system is a software application designed to help individuals and
teams organize, plan, execute, and manage projects from their desktop computers. These systems
offer a wide range of features to facilitate project planning, scheduling, resource allocation, task
management, collaboration, and reporting.
Task Management: Desktop project management systems provide tools for creating and
assigning tasks, setting deadlines, tracking progress, and managing dependencies between
tasks.
Resource Allocation: These systems allow users to allocate resources such as personnel,
equipment, and materials to specific tasks or projects, helping to optimize resource utilization.
Scheduling: Users can create project schedules, set milestones, and visualize project timelines
to effectively plan and manage project activities.
Collaboration: Many desktop project management systems offer collaboration features such
as file sharing, communication tools, and team messaging to facilitate teamwork and
information sharing.
Reporting and Analytics: These systems often include reporting capabilities that enable users
to generate various types of reports, analyze project performance, and track key metrics.
The following are the five personal project software systems and their qualities and why we
have selected these and left others in description;
1
1. MICROSOFT PROJECT (A free software).
Here as follow below are some qualities and examples of Microsoft Project software:
i. Comprehensive Project Planning: Microsoft Project offers a wide range of tools and features
that allow project managers to create detailed project plans. It includes features like task
scheduling, resource allocation, and dependency management. Project managers can break
down projects into tasks, assign resources, set durations, and establish dependencies between
tasks to create a comprehensive project plan.
Example: A project manager can use Microsoft Project to create a project plan for developing a
new software application. They can define tasks such as requirements gathering, design, coding,
testing, and deployment, assign resources to each task, set durations, and establish dependencies
between tasks.
ii. Resource Management: Microsoft Project provides robust resource management capabilities.
Project managers can allocate resources to tasks, track resource utilization, and manage
resource availability. It allows managers to identify resource overloads, balance workloads,
and make adjustments to optimize resource utilization. Example: In a construction project, a
project manager can use Microsoft Project to allocate construction workers to specific tasks,
such as excavation, framing, plumbing, and electrical work. They can track the availability and
utilization of each worker and make adjustments to ensure an optimal allocation of resources.
iii. Timeline Visualization: Microsoft Project offers various visual tools to represent project
timelines. Gantt charts, for example, provide a graphical representation of project tasks,
durations, and dependencies. Project managers can easily view the overall project timeline,
identify critical path tasks, and track progress against the planned schedule. Example: A
marketing manager can use Microsoft Project to create a Gantt chart to visualize the timeline
for a marketing campaign. They can represent tasks such as market research, campaign
planning, content creation, and advertising activities on the chart, along with their respective
durations and dependencies.
2
There are several reasons why project managers choose to Microsoft Project for project
planning and management:
ii. Offline Accessibility; One of the major advantages of the desktop version is that it allows
project managers to work offline. They can create, edit, and update project plans without
requiring an internet connection.
iii. Performance and Speed; The desktop version of Microsoft Project often offers faster
performance compared to web-based or cloud-based project management tools. It can handle
large and complex project plans more efficiently, enabling project managers to work with a
large number of tasks, resources, and dependencies
why someone would choose to use software for project management instead of other
methods? There are several reasons why people and organizations prefer to use software for
project management:
i. Efficiency: Project management software provides tools and features that help streamline and
automate many aspects of project management. It allows for efficient task tracking, resource
allocation, scheduling, and collaboration, which can save a significant amount of time and
effort compared to manual methods.
ii. Scalability: Software tools are designed to handle projects of all sizes and complexities. They
can accommodate multiple projects simultaneously, handle large volumes of data, and support
a growing number of team members. As your project grows, you can easily scale up your
project management software to meet your evolving needs.
is primarily used for software development teams to plan, track, and manage projects and issues
throughout the development lifecycle. It offers a wide range of features and functionalities that
support agile project management methodologies such as Scrum and Kanban. (PMBOK®Guide;
5th ed.). (2013).
3
Here are the qualities and examples of JIRA software tool in project planning and
management:
i. Issue Tracking; JIRA excels in issue tracking, allowing users to create, assign, and track
issues throughout the development lifecycle. It provides a centralized system to manage bugs,
tasks, user stories, and other project-related issues. Example: A software development team
can use JIRA to create and track bugs reported by testers, assign tasks to team members, and
ensure timely resolution of issues.
ii. Agile Project Management; JIRA is widely recognized for its support of agile
methodologies, such as Scrum and Kanban. It offers features like boards, backlogs, and sprints
to help teams plan, prioritize, and execute their work in an iterative and incremental manner.
Example: A Scrum team can use JIRA boards to visualize their sprint backlog, track progress
during daily stand-ups, and manage tasks using agile principles.
iii. Customizable Workflows: JIRA allows users to create custom workflows tailored to their
specific project requirements. Workflows define the status transitions and approvals that issues
go through, ensuring a consistent and streamlined process. Example: An organization can
design a workflow in JIRA for managing change requests, including review, approval,
development, and testing stages.
The reasons why project managers might choose to use JIRA for project planning and
management:
ii. Customizability: JIRA offers a high degree of customization, allowing project managers to
adapt the tool to their specific project requirements and workflows. Customizable fields,
workflows, and boards ensure that JIRA can align with the unique needs of different projects
and teams.
iii. Reporting and Analytics; JIRA offers built-in reporting and analytics features that provide
insights into project progress, team performance, and issue statistics. Project managers can
generate reports and visualizations to monitor key metrics, identify bottlenecks, and make
data-driven decisions.
4
Why choosing JIRA and left other in project planning and management?
Here are some reasons why people choose to use JIRA for project planning in a desktop
management system:
i. Agile Methodology Support: JIRA is well-suited for teams following agile methodologies
such as Scrum or Kanban. It provides features like user story management, sprint planning,
backlog prioritization, and agile boards for visualizing and managing project progress. If your
development team follows an agile approach, JIRA can provide the necessary tools and
workflows to support your planning and execution.
ii. Issue Tracking and Workflow Management: JIRA excels at issue tracking, allowing you to
create and manage tasks, bugs, and other work items. It provides customizable workflows that
can be tailored to match your team's specific processes and requirements. With JIRA, you can
easily track the status of tasks, assign them to team members, set priorities, and monitor
progress.
Smartsheet is a versatile project management software that provides tools for project planning,
task tracking, resource management, and collaboration. It offers customizable templates and
supports automation. Also Smartsheet is a cloud-based project management and collaboration
tool that is accessible via desktop and other devices. It provides a range of features to help
teams plan, track, and manage projects effectively. While it is primarily cloud-based, it also
offers desktop applications for Windows and macOS that allow users to work offline and
synchronize their data once they're back online. Khan, A, et all. (2012).
Here are some qualities and examples of worksheets desktop project management system in
project planning and management:
i. Task Tracking: Worksheets can be used to create a task list, assign tasks to team members,
set deadlines, and monitor task progress. Each row in the worksheet represents a task, and
columns can include task name, assigned team member, start and end dates, status, priority,
and any relevant notes or attachments.
ii. Resource Allocation; Worksheets can help manage and allocate project resources efficiently.
You can create columns to track resource availability, assign resources to specific tasks, and
monitor resource utilization.
5
iii. Budget and Expense Tracking; Worksheets can be used to track project budgets and
expenses. You can create columns to record estimated costs, actual expenses, and variances.
Formulas can be used to calculate totals, percentages, and remaining budget.
Examples of desktop project management software that utilize worksheets include Microsoft
Excel, Google Sheets, and other spreadsheet applications. These tools provide the necessary
functionalities to create, update, and analyze project-related worksheets, allowing project managers
and teams to effectively plan, track, and manage projects.
Here are several reasons why project managers choose to use worksheets for project
planning and management:
i. Offline Access: Desktop worksheets allow project managers to work on their projects even
when they don't have an internet connection. This is particularly useful in situations where
internet access may be limited or unreliable. Project managers can continue planning,
updating, and analyzing project data without interruption.
ii. Advanced Functionality: Desktop worksheets often offer more advanced functionality
compared to online or cloud-based tools. They provide a wide range of features, formulas, and
data manipulation capabilities that allow project managers to perform complex calculations,
create custom formulas, and generate customized reports.
iii. Data Security: Some project managers prefer using desktop worksheets to maintain greater
control over their project data and ensure its security. By keeping project data stored locally on
their computers or within their organization's network, project managers can have more control
over data access and minimize the risks associated with data breaches or unauthorized access.
Why Using Smartsheet for project planning and management, can offer several benefits.
Here are some reasons why people choose to use Smartsheet and left others
ii. Collaboration and Sharing: Smartsheet offers robust collaboration features, allowing team
members to work together on project plans in real-time. Multiple users can simultaneously edit
and update project data, ensuring everyone has access to the latest information. Smartsheet
6
also supports file attachments, discussions, and notifications, facilitating efficient
communication and collaboration.
Is a cloud-based project management tool that offers a comprehensive set of features for team
collaboration and task management. It is available as a web application and can also be accessed
through desktop and mobile apps.It offers features such as task assignments, due dates, file
attachments, and project timelines. Asana also provides a visual project timeline view, which helps
users track the progress of their projects. Caniëls, M. (2012).
Here are the qualities and examples of ASANA software tool in project planning and
management:
ii. Task Management: One of the core qualities of Asana is its robust task management
capabilities. In the context of desktop software project planning, Asana allows users to create
tasks, assign them to team members, set due dates, and track the progress of each task. This
feature is essential for breaking down complex software development projects into
manageable tasks and ensuring that team members are clear about their responsibilities.
iii. Reporting Tools: In project management, data-driven insights are crucial for making
informed decisions and evaluating progress. Asana provides reporting tools that enable users
to generate custom reports, track key metrics, visualize project data, and gain valuable
insights into team performance and project outcomes.
The several reasons why Asana stands out as a top choice for desktop software project
planning management and left others;
i. Asana stands out as a comprehensive desktop software; due to its user-friendly interface,
robust task management capabilities, seamless collaboration features, advanced reporting
tools, adaptability to different methodologies, extensive integrations with other business
applications, emphasis on user experience, accessibility, and commitment to continuous
improvement.
7
ii. Workflow Automation: Asana offers automation features that streamline repetitive tasks and
processes. Users can create custom rules to automate actions, such as task assignment,
notifications, and updates based on specific triggers or events.
iii. Flexibility and Scalability: Asana is designed to be flexible and scalable, catering to the
needs of small teams as well as large enterprises. Its customizable features and adaptable
structure make it suitable for diverse project management requirements.
Why choosing Asana and left other in project planning and management and left others;
i. Integration with Other Tools: Asana integrates with a wide range of third-party tools, such
as Google Drive, Slack, and Trello. This allows users to connect their existing tools and
workflows with Asana, ensuring a smooth transition and minimizing disruptions to their
current processes.
ii. Mobile Apps: Asana offers mobile apps for iOS and Android devices, enabling users to
manage their projects on-the-go. This flexibility allows team members to stay connected and
updated even when they are away from their desks.
is another popular project management tool that uses a visual approach to organize tasks and
projects. It is available and accessed through desktop and mobile apps. The platform is designed to
help teams and individuals manage their projects efficiently, track progress, and enhance
collaboration. Larson, E. et all (2014).
i. It is visual organization system. The platform uses boards, lists, and cards to represent tasks
and projects. Users can create different boards for various projects, lists for different stages of
a project, and cards for individual tasks. This visual approach makes it easy for team members
to see the status of tasks at a glance and understand the overall progress of a project.
ii. Accessibility; As a desktop software, Trello provides offline access to boards and cards,
allowing users to continue working on their projects even without an internet connection. This
accessibility is valuable for users who need to work in environments with limited or no
internet access.
8
iii. Cost-Effective: Trello offers a free version with basic features, making it accessible to small
teams and individuals. The paid version, Trello Business Class, provides additional features
and security options at a reasonable cost.
The following are reasons why Trello stands out as a preferred choice for project planning
management over other options;
i. It is affordable. The platform offers a free version with essential features that cater to the
needs of small teams or individual users. It is available not only as desktop software but also
as a web application and mobile app for iOS and Android devices. This ensures that users can
access their projects and collaborate with their teams from anywhere, at any time.
ii. User-Friendly Interface. One of the key reasons for choosing Trello is its user-friendly
interface. The platform’s intuitive design allows users to easily create and manage tasks,
assign them to team members, and track progress. The drag-and-drop functionality makes it
simple to organize and prioritize tasks, which enhances overall productivity and efficiency.
Why choosing Trello and left other in project planning and management and left others;
9
Reference
A guide to the project management body of knowledge (PMBOK®Guide; 5th ed.). (2013).
Newtown Square, PA: Project Management Institute, Inc.
Caniëls, M. C., & Bakens, R. J. (2012). The effects of Project Management Information Systems on
decision making in a multi project environment. International Journal of Project
Management 30(2)
Du, S. M., Johnson, R. D., & Keil, M. (2004). Project management courses in IS graduate
programs: What is being taught? Journal of Information Systems Education.
Khan, A., Bindra, G. S., Arora, R., Raj, N., Jain, D., & Shrivastava, D. (2012). Cloud service for
comprehensive project management software. 6th International Conference on
Application of Information and Communication Technologies (AICT), Tbilisi, pp. 1.
Landry, J., & McDaniel, R. (2016). Agile preparation within a traditional project management
course. Information Systems Education Journal 14(6), 27-33. Retrieved fro
Larson, E. W., & Gray, C. F. (2014). Project Management: The Managerial Process with MS
Project. Retrieve
10